Abstract

The invention relates to a method and system for reducing turbo lag in an engine. A method and control module for controlling an engine includes a requested torque module that generates a requested torque and a turbo boost level module that determines a desired boost level based on the driver requested torque. The control module further includes a pulse determination module that determines a primary fuel injection pulsewidth and a secondary fuel injection pulsewidth based on the driver requested torque and the desired boost level and controls a first injection into the cylinder with the primary fuel injection pulsewidth and a second injection into the cylinder with the secondary fuel injection pulsewidth.

[0003] Internal combustion engines combust an air and fuel mixture in cylinders to drive pistons, which produce drive torque. Air flow into a gasoline engine is regulated by a throttle. More specifically, the throttle adjusts the throttle area to increase or decrease the flow of air into the engine. As the throttle area increases, air flow into the engine increases.
